Shooting in the dark<br />

Adjusting the ISO sensitivity<br />

The ISO sensitivity is the measure of a film’s sensitivity to light as<br />

defined by the International Organization for Standardization (ISO).<br />

The higher ISO sensitivity you select, the more sensitive to light<br />

your camera becomes. With a higher ISO sensitivity, you can get<br />

a better photo without using the flash.<br />

1 In a Shooting mode, touch → ISO.<br />

2 Select an option, and then touch .<br />

• Select to have the camera select an appropriate ISO<br />

sensitivity automatically based on the brightness of the subject<br />

and lighting.<br />

ISO<br />

Higher ISO sensitivities may result in more image noise.<br />
